Moms With MS
One recent niche that I have just started scratching the surface of is that of Mothers who are diagnosed with Multiple Sclerosis. It is one of those demographics that upon doing some research seemed almost painfully obvious as an under-represented group. Most people diagnosed with Multiple Sclerosis are women who are between the ages of 20-40 years old, years described as being the fertile years of a woman’s life! All of these woman either have kids, want kids, or have consciously decided they do not want kids and are taking actions to avoid getting pregnant. Upon doing some basic user research, I found that most sites that cater to those diagnosed with this chronic illness group these women along with parents whose children have been diagnosed with Multiple Sclerosis, which is a VERY different demographic.
